Common Washer Problems We Repair

Washer Not Draining

If your washer fills and agitates but water won’t drain at the end of the cycle, clothes remain soaking wet, and cycles stall, it’s a common issue often caused by a clogged drain hose, blocked pump, faulty drain pump, or a malfunctioning lid switch.

Typical repair cost: $120–$250, depending on the model and parts required.

How we help:

Our technicians remove the washer’s back or front panel to inspect the drain hose and pump for clogs, kinks, or damage.

The drain pump is tested for proper operation, and any electrical connections or switches related to draining are checked.

We examine the lid switch or door lock mechanism to ensure the washer can safely initiate the drain cycle.

Any worn, clogged, or broken components are replaced with OEM or certified parts.

Finally, we run multiple test cycles with water to confirm the washer drains completely, operates quietly, and leaves clothes properly spun.

This method ensures your washer drains efficiently without risking damage to your machine or laundry.

Washer Not Spinning

If your washer fills with water but refuses to spin, clothes stay wet and cycles take much longer than normal. This is a common problem caused by issues like a broken drive belt, worn motor coupler, faulty lid switch, or a malfunctioning transmission.

Typical repair cost: $150–$300, depending on the model and parts required.

How we help:

Our technicians open the washer cabinet to inspect the drive belt, motor coupler, and pulleys for wear or breakage.

We test the lid switch with a multimeter to confirm electrical continuity and ensure the machine can safely start spinning.

The motor and transmission are checked for proper voltage, torque, and smooth operation.

Any worn or broken components are replaced with OEM or certified parts.

Finally, we run multiple test loads to confirm the drum spins correctly under normal load conditions and the washer operates quietly and efficiently.

This approach ensures your washer is restored to full function without causing damage to your clothes or machine.

Leaking Washer

If your washer is leaking water during a cycle, it can cause water damage to your floor and disrupt laundry. Common causes include a worn door seal, loose or cracked hoses, a faulty pump, or a damaged tub gasket.

Typical repair cost: $100–$300, depending on the model and parts required.

How we help:

Our technicians inspect all hoses, clamps, and connections for cracks, leaks, or loose fittings.

We check the door seal or lid gasket for wear, tears, or improper sealing.

The drain pump and tub are examined for leaks or cracks.

Any defective or worn components are replaced with OEM or certified parts.

Finally, we run multiple test cycles with water to confirm there are no leaks, the washer operates safely, and your laundry stays dry.

This approach ensures your washer is leak-free while protecting your floors and home.

Washer Making Loud Noises or Vibrating Excessively

If your washer rattles, bangs, or shakes violently during cycles, it can damage internal components and even your flooring. Common causes include worn drum bearings, unbalanced loads, damaged suspension rods, or a loose drive pulley.

Typical repair cost: $150–$400, depending on the model and parts required.

How we help:

Our technicians inspect the drum, bearings, and suspension system for wear, damage, or misalignment.

The drive pulley, motor, and belts are checked for proper tension and secure installation.

We evaluate load distribution and confirm the washer is level to prevent excessive vibration.

Any worn, broken, or misaligned components are replaced with OEM or certified parts.

Finally, we run multiple test cycles to ensure the washer operates quietly, spins evenly, and handles normal loads without vibration or noise.

This process restores smooth, quiet operation while protecting both your machine and your home.

Washer Won’t Start / Door Won’t Lock

If your washer won’t start or the door/ lid refuses to lock, the cycle won’t begin, leaving laundry undone. Common causes include a faulty lid switch, broken door lock mechanism, blown fuses, or electrical issues.

Typical repair cost: $120–$250, depending on the model and parts required.

How we help:

Our technicians test the lid switch or door lock assembly for proper operation and electrical continuity.

The washer’s wiring, fuses, and control board are inspected for faults or shorts.

Any defective or worn components, including switches, locks, or electrical parts, are replaced with OEM or certified parts.

We verify that the door locks securely and that the machine can safely start cycles.

Finally, we run multiple test cycles to ensure the washer starts correctly, the door locks reliably, and your laundry is completed safely.

This method restores full operation while preventing electrical or mechanical hazards.

Types of Washers We Repair

Front-Load Washers

Front-load washers have a horizontal drum that spins clothes through a tumbling motion. They are energy and water-efficient, gentle on fabrics, and usually have faster spin speeds than top-load models.

Common problems include worn bearings, door seal leaks, and drum alignment issues.

These washers often require careful handling during repairs due to their complex drum and motor assembly.

Top-Load Washers (Agitator)

Traditional top-load washers use a central agitator to move clothes through water. They are simple, durable, and typically have shorter cycle times.

Common issues include broken drive belts, worn agitator dogs, and motor coupling failures.

Repairs are generally straightforward, with easy access to belts, pulleys, and the transmission.

Top-Load Washers (High-Efficiency / Impeller)

These top-load washers don’t have a central agitator but use a low-profile impeller to move clothes. They are more water and energy-efficient than agitator models, and tend to be gentler on clothing.

Common problems include impeller damage, sensor failures, or water inlet issues.

Repairs may require motor diagnostics and testing of water level and fill sensors.

Washer–Dryer Combos (2-in-1 Units)

Combo washers wash and dry clothes in a single drum, making them ideal for apartments or condos with limited space.

Common problems include dryer heating failures that leave clothes damp, drum imbalance that causes excessive vibration, and pump malfunctions that prevent proper drainage.

Repairs must address both washing and drying components to restore full functionality.

Stacked Washer & Dryer Units / Laundry Centers

Stacked washer and dryer units save floor space while providing full-size capacity.

Common problems include drums not spinning, leaks from hoses or seals, and pump failures that interrupt cycles.

Repairs involve careful inspection of both units’ mechanical and plumbing components to ensure reliable operation.

High-Efficiency (HE) Washers

HE washers use sensors to optimize water and detergent for more efficient cleaning while saving resources.

Common problems include sensor malfunctions that cause incomplete cycles, drainage issues that leave clothes wet, and drum imbalance that creates noise or vibration.

Repairs require testing both electronic and mechanical systems to restore proper function.

Smart / Wi-Fi Enabled Washers

Smart washers connect to apps for cycle monitoring, alerts, and remote adjustments.

Common problems include connectivity failures that prevent app control, sensor errors that stop cycles, and software glitches affecting timing or operation.

Repairs often require diagnosing both electronic controls and network connections to ensure reliable performance.

Steam Washers

Steam washers use high-temperature steam to sanitize fabrics and remove tough stains.

Common problems include steam generator failures that prevent proper cleaning, sensor malfunctions that stop cycles, and gasket leaks that cause water to escape.

Repairs involve checking heating elements, sensors, and seals to maintain safe and effective operation.

Built-In / Under-Counter Washers

Compact washers installed under counters in kitchens or condos.

Common problems include pump failures that prevent drainage, door latch problems that stop cycles, and minor leaks from hoses or seals.

Repairs require careful access to internal components without damaging cabinetry.

Slim / Narrow Washers

Slim washers are designed for tight laundry spaces while maintaining full functionality.

Common problems include motor overheating, drum imbalance that causes vibration or noise, and sensor errors that interrupt cycles.

Repairs often involve testing electrical components, balancing the drum, and ensuring proper water flow.

1. Is it worth it to repair my appliance?

That's the most common question in our industry.

As a general rule, if your appliance is newer (under 8 years old) and the repair costs less than half of what a new one would cost, it's usually worth fixing. We'll give you an honest assessment and clear repair quote so you can make the best decision.
